Pilbara Minerals secures $165m to help crucial minerals manufacturing


Pilbara Minerals (PLS) has obtained a A$250m ($164.95m) mortgage from the Australian Authorities to broaden its mining and processing operations within the Pilbara area, Western Australia.

These operations are engaged within the manufacturing of lithium-containing spodumene and tantalite concentrates.

The ten-year debt facility might be supplied by way of the Export Finance Australia (EFA) and Northern Australia Infrastructure Facility (NAIF) businesses, with every of them contributing A$125m.

This funding might be used for the P680 Mission enlargement to the Pilgan Plant to ship a further spodumene focus manufacturing of 100,000 tonnes every year (tpa), with estimated capital price of $103m.

Pilbara Minerals can even use the financing to construct the 5Mtpa crushing and ore sorting facility to exchange the present contracted crushing facility.

The brand new facility can be anticipated to allow manufacturing of 1Mtpa of spodumene focus capability throughout Pilbara Minerals’ complete Pilgangoora Operation.

This debt facility is topic to the ultimate negotiation of its phrases, detailed financing paperwork’ completion, and fulfilment of situations ‘precedent for monetary shut and drawdown’.

Pilbara Minerals stated in an announcement: “It’s anticipated that key phrases of the power will mirror present market situations for the kind and measurement of the debt being supplied and is anticipated to be finalised throughout this quarter.”

Claimed to be the world’s largest uncommon earths producer exterior of China, Australia has been trying to diversify crucial minerals procurement amid mounting tensions between Western governments and China, reported Reuters.

Northern Australia Sources Minister Madeleine King stated: “The worldwide path to internet zero runs by way of the Australian sources sector and producing battery supplies is a crucial contributor to a decrease carbon financial system.

“The NAIF has now made financing commitments of $3.87bn to initiatives throughout Northern Australia, with round $1.9bn of that in Western Australia (WA).

“In complete, the initiatives throughout WA are forecast to help greater than 6,380 jobs and ship greater than $17.4bn in financial affect, which might be transformational.”
